How much social security does Chongqing individual pay a month?

There are two ways for individuals to pay social security: individual payment and company payment.

Personal payment means that your household registration is in Chongqing, and you can pay pension (urban and rural residents' pension insurance) and medical insurance in your own name.

The company pays the following five insurances for urban workers through the human resources company in its company account, including pension, medical care, unemployment, work injury and maternity. Social insurance is a social and economic system that provides income or compensation for those who lose their ability to work, are temporarily unemployed or suffer losses due to health reasons. The main items of social insurance include endowment insurance, medical insurance, unemployment insurance, industrial injury insurance and maternity insurance.

The social insurance plan is organized by the government, forcing a certain group to use part of its income as social insurance tax (fee) to form a social insurance fund. Under certain conditions, the insured can get fixed income or loss compensation from the fund. It is a redistribution system, and its goal is to ensure the reproduction of material and labor and social stability.

In China, social insurance is an important part of the social security system, occupying a core position in the whole social security system. In addition, social insurance is a contributory social security. The funds are mainly paid by employers and workers themselves, and the government finances give subsidies and bear the ultimate responsibility. However, workers can only enjoy the corresponding social insurance benefits if they fulfill their statutory payment obligations and meet the statutory conditions.
